 |  | January 20, 1692
Dear Little Book,
Mother and Father have forbidden
me to have anything to do with Martha.
I, being afeard, asked why. Mother just told me that she is
ill and it is contagious. I really do not believe that. Martha
has never been ill in her life!
My neighbor, Anna Paxton, a gossipy, wrinkly,
old crone, came over this
afternoon. I was up in the loft, but I could still hear all
she said to Mother.
"Have ye heard 'bout that Martha child?" she hissed.
My mother did not reply. Maybe she nodded.
"I swear, the devil hisself has gotten into that girl.
Ye know how she loves ter go upon the hill, and ye know what
lives there. Old Myr, that witch. None of the officials have
caught her yet, for most o' them be afeard. I reckon she..."
Miss Paxton lowered her voice, and I could not hear it.
My mother obviously disagreed with whatever had been said,
for she began to rant.
"Martha? Sell her soul to the Devil?" Up in the
loft, I crossed myself.
"I highly doubt any Christian
girl would do tha'! And Martha! As sweet as a girl you could
ever find!"
There was a long silence, then Anna replied,
"Fine, if ye dinna take me word for it, then God help
ye. That Martha be possessed." With that, Anna Paxton
left in a huff.
Oh, Little Book, I am afeard! I must see
Martha, and soon.
